There are “amazing dorm amenities” like free printer paper or Davidson’s free laundry service– and then there’s High Point University. The student perks High Point offers are so astonishing, so completely mind-blowing, it makes you wonder whether such a place actually exists:
- The school has an ice-cream truck that circles the campus handing out free frozen treats to students. There are 500 things to choose from. And it’s there EVERY DAY.
- On their birthday, every single one of the 2,000 undergrads receives a birthday card signed by the school president with a Starbucks gift card inside. Oh, and balloons! When that student’s I.D. card is swiped at the cafeteria, the kitchen staff is alerted that the birthday boy or girl has arrived, so they know to prepare a slice of cake and dispatch a group of musicians to sing “Happy Birthday.”
- The university’s cafeteria features live music on a daily basis. A jazz quartet may play one day, while a folk duo may show up the next. Music not your thing? A bevy of flat screen TVs are also available.
- Next to the cafeteria is a concierge desk, which helps students with maintenance requests, restaurant recommendations, and even sends out dry cleaning. Who needs an alarm clock? Student can also request the desk to give them an automated wake-up call in the morning.
- Snack carts around campus hand out free bananas, pretzels and drinks.
- When students come back from breaks, gifts await them. Not like that’s a big deal, since the school just gives out presents on random days for no apparent reason. The university keeps track of each student’s preferences (movies, candy bars, sodas, etc.) so everyone gets what they want.
- There’s an enormous hot tub in the middle of campus.
Why all the stuff? High Point president Nido Qubein reasons, “When the students know you care, they reward you by doing well in the classroom. Then they reward you by telling their friends and by their parents’ becoming your donors.”
The school is planning to offer more amenities in the future, including a steakhouse. Really, High Point University? REALLY?
